Preventing Costly Mistakes with Your Fence Purchase
Before you head off to the showroom to pick out a new fence, do yourself a favor and learn what you need to look for, first. All you really need is some kind of idea about what you want and why, and then maybe talk to a fence professional who can lead you through the rest. All things generally flow from what you have in mind for your property. In this article, we'll talk about some things you should think about before you talk to any sales person.
You want to maintain cordial relations, I'm sure, with the folks you have to live next to. It's natural to presume that if you want a fence then you just get one, but it's really a good idea to just let your neighbors know and of course it depends on what kind of fence you're getting. This is really easy to check on, and you can even find out probably online regarding zoning requirements and permits for this and that. Also, you may live in a development that has a little club of people who enforce things to keep the place looking good - so you may have to get permission.
Don't forget to learn everything about the terms of purchase and warranty policies. Get the paperwork and see it in print and avoid taking anything at face value because that won't hold up in court if it gets to that. On the other hand, it is ultimately the business you buy it from that has to implement the warranty, and that is an area that could potentially harbor some difficulties. You can get in trouble sometimes with buying fences from a large chain store because they can contract it out to anybody.
